Show that the normal component of electrostatic field has a discontinuity from one side of a charged surface to another given by
`(oversetrarr(E_2)-oversetrarr(E_1))overset^n=sigma//epsilon_0` where `overset^n` isa unit vecotr normal to the surface at a point and ct is the surface charge density at that point. (The direction of `overset^n` is from side 1 to side 2.) Hence, show that just outside a conductor, the electric field is `sigmaoverset^n//epsilon_0`.
